New test of punishment beyond the verdict
For the past fourteen years, the Supreme Court has spent a good deal of time and energy sorting out the constitutional roles of judges and juries in the system of punishment for federal crimes. The process has made even more puzzling an already complex array of federal sentencing guidelines.
